CBC PROFILE: Terry Kimbrow Retirement Celebration
Central Baptist College invites you to President Terry Kimbrow’s retirement celebration on May 9, 2025, at 4 p.m.
President Kimbrow first came to CBC as a student in 1987 after surrendering to the ministry earlier that year. He then returned to serve as vice president for Institutional Advancement in 1992 and held that position for 10 years before transitioning to executive vice president in 2003.
Kimbrow was inaugurated as the ninth president of Central Baptist College in 2004 and has faithfully served for 21 years, making him the longest-serving president in CBC’s history.
During his time here, President Kimbrow has overseen and led in the construction of the Ratliff Bell Tower, Watkins Academic Building, Story Library and Dickson Hall. He also oversaw the completion of the Judy Gabbard Science Center, saw a dramatic increase in the number of academic offerings at the four-year level, led in the addition of the teacher education program and developed a plan to offer free counseling services for all students.
On March 11, 2024, President Kimbrow announced his plans to retire in May 2025. The Board of Trustees has appointed Dr. Jeremy Langley to the position of Executive Vice President. President Kimbrow is working alongside Dr. Langley, who will become interim president on May 27.
